Transaction 7125b59387f81603a7aa5f7df8088a422e72c933c67b8c2572871979ceaf3114

1 Input
1 Outputs
  • 7125b59387f81603a7aa5f7df8088a422e72c933c67b8c2572871979ceaf3114:0
  • value  43492
    address  3CWH9hPBDxJJjeekTqQbpRt4j6Z65MBiDc